Jinxd12 Posted August 30, 2022 Author Report Share Posted August 30, 2022 Got some new paints coming and looking to dial in on a few patterns I can keep consistent. Probably stick with crappie/perch/bluegill/trout patterns until I can progress through those. I have a few baits out and about and the only negative feedback so far has been the same 3 things (small things). Make sure the eyes aren't hazy(I think the glue is off gassing), clean up the edges of the lips(simple step I missed), and obviously get the clear coat perfect if I want to get a good price for them. All 3 of those things are semi easy to clean up. And none effect the swim. KBS has been easy to use, except it's been inconsistent. Probably doesn't help that it's still 100+ degrees in my garage still causing the stuff to dry to quickly causing air bubbles. Anyways here is the finished trout patterns, pretty dang happy with it! Jinxd12 Posted August 31, 2022 Author Report Share Posted August 31, 2022 24 minutes ago, Big Epp said: I was poking around online and found this old article about painting a realistic bluegill. https://www.taxidermy.net/ken/?p=1070 That's a pretty good article I think I've seen that one before. Ive posted one here also somewhere. The problem isn't the painting of the bait, the problem is not good enough with the airbrush yet. Lots of control, pressures, angles, paint types etc. Got to dial that all in and then it will all mesh. I've only had the airbrush since father's day, so just trying to set aside a little time every week to rip through a few new paints, angles, pressures has been the goal.
